landuseSmithTrager attorneys have substantial experience representing clients in remediating, appraising, positioning, enhancing, selling, leasing, financing and developing contaminated properties.

As a part of our "Brownfields" practice, we draft and negotiate remediation/disposition and development agreements and negotiate with regulatory agencies on cleanup options and alternatives.
